+#ifndef _PATRICIA_H
+#define _PATRICIA_H
+
+/* { from defs.h */
+#define prefix_touchar(prefix) ((unsigned char *)&(prefix)->add.sin)
+#define MAXLINE 1024
+#define BIT_TEST(f, b) ((f) & (b))
+/* } */
+
+#include <netinet/in.h> /* for struct in_addr */
+#include <sys/socket.h> /* for AF_INET */
+
+/* { from mrt.h */
+typedef struct _prefix_t
+{
+ unsigned short family; /* AF_INET | AF_INET6 */
+ unsigned short bitlen; /* same as mask? */
+ int ref_count; /* reference count */
+
+ union
+ {
+ struct in_addr sin;
+ struct in6_addr sin6;
+ } add;
+} prefix_t;
+/* } */
+
+typedef struct _patricia_node_t
+{
+ unsigned int bit; /* flag if this node used */
+ prefix_t *prefix; /* who we are in patricia tree */
+ struct _patricia_node_t *l, *r; /* left and right children */
+ struct _patricia_node_t *parent; /* may be used */
+ void *data; /* pointer to data */
+ void *user1; /* pointer to usr data (ex. route flap info) */
+} patricia_node_t;
+
+typedef struct _patricia_tree_t
+{
+ patricia_node_t *head;
+ unsigned int maxbits; /* for IP, 32 bit addresses */
+ int num_active_node; /* for debug purpose */
+} patricia_tree_t;
+
+
+extern patricia_node_t *patricia_search_exact(patricia_tree_t *, prefix_t *);
+extern patricia_node_t *patricia_search_best(patricia_tree_t *, prefix_t *);
+extern patricia_node_t *patricia_search_best2(patricia_tree_t *, prefix_t *, int);
+extern patricia_node_t *patricia_lookup(patricia_tree_t *, prefix_t *);
+extern void patricia_remove(patricia_tree_t *, patricia_node_t *);
+extern patricia_tree_t *patricia_new(unsigned int);
+extern void patricia_clear(patricia_tree_t *, void (*)(void *));
+extern void patricia_destroy(patricia_tree_t *, void (*)(void *));
+extern void patricia_process(patricia_tree_t *, void (*)(prefix_t *, void *));
+extern const char *patricia_prefix_toa(const prefix_t *, int);
+extern void patricia_lookup_then_remove(patricia_tree_t *, const char *);
+extern patricia_node_t *patricia_try_search_exact(patricia_tree_t *, const char *);
+extern patricia_node_t *patricia_try_search_best(patricia_tree_t *, const char *);
+extern patricia_node_t *patricia_try_search_exact_addr(patricia_tree_t *, struct sockaddr *, int);
+extern patricia_node_t *patricia_try_search_best_addr(patricia_tree_t *, struct sockaddr *, int);
+
+/* { from demo.c */
+extern patricia_node_t *patricia_make_and_lookup(patricia_tree_t *, const char *);
+/* } */
+
+#define PATRICIA_MAXBITS (sizeof(struct in6_addr) * 8)
+#define PATRICIA_NBIT(x) (0x80 >> ((x) & 0x7f))
+#define PATRICIA_NBYTE(x) ((x) >> 3)
+
+#define PATRICIA_DATA_GET(node, type) (type *)((node)->data)
+#define PATRICIA_DATA_SET(node, value) ((node)->data = (void *)(value))
+
+#define PATRICIA_WALK(Xhead, Xnode) \
+ do { \
+ patricia_node_t *Xstack[PATRICIA_MAXBITS + 1]; \
+ patricia_node_t **Xsp = Xstack; \
+ patricia_node_t *Xrn = (Xhead); \
+ while ((Xnode = Xrn)) { \
+ if (Xnode->prefix)
+
+#define PATRICIA_WALK_ALL(Xhead, Xnode) \
+ do { \
+ patricia_node_t *Xstack[PATRICIA_MAXBITS + 1]; \
+ patricia_node_t **Xsp = Xstack; \
+ patricia_node_t *Xrn = (Xhead); \
+ while ((Xnode = Xrn)) { \
+ if (1)
+
+#define PATRICIA_WALK_BREAK { \
+ if (Xsp != Xstack) { \
+ Xrn = *(--Xsp); \
+ } else { \
+ Xrn = (patricia_node_t *)0; \
+ } \
+ continue; }
+
+#define PATRICIA_WALK_END \
+ if (Xrn->l) { \
+ if (Xrn->r) { \
+ *Xsp++ = Xrn->r; \
+ } \
+ Xrn = Xrn->l; \
+ } else if (Xrn->r) { \
+ Xrn = Xrn->r; \
+ } else if (Xsp != Xstack) { \
+ Xrn = *(--Xsp); \
+ } else { \
+ Xrn = (patricia_node_t *)0; \
+ } \
+ } \
+} while (0)
+
+#endif
